Liquid cooled synchronous motor is a type of synchronous motor that uses a liquid cooling system to dissipate heat. This type of motor is typically used for applications that require high power density and high performance, such as industrial machinery, electric vehicles, ships, and other fields that require high power output.

In liquid cooled synchronous motors, high rotational accuracy refers to the ability of the motor to maintain a stable rotational speed during operation, and requires high precision in speed control. This accuracy usually depends on factors such as optimization of motor design, stability of control system, and accuracy of feedback system.

Motor design and manufacturing quality: High quality motor design and manufacturing can ensure the accuracy and stability of various components inside the motor, thereby helping to improve rotational accuracy.

Control system design: A precise control system can accurately monitor the rotational speed of the motor and adjust the control signal in a timely manner to achieve the required rotational accuracy. Closed loop control systems are commonly used to improve accuracy, where feedback devices such as encoders are used to monitor the rotor position of the motor in real-time.

Cooling system design: The liquid cooling system can effectively control the temperature of the motor, preventing performance degradation and reduced rotational accuracy caused by overheating.

The stability of mechanical systems: The stability of mechanical structures is also crucial for the rotational accuracy of motors. Reducing vibration and mechanical looseness can help ensure the stability of the rotating system, thereby improving rotational accuracy.

To achieve high rotational accuracy of liquid cooled synchronous motors, multiple factors such as motor design, manufacturing quality, control system design, cooling system design, and mechanical system stability need to be comprehensively considered.
